How much do fresh graduate chemical engineer jobs pay per year?

As of Jul 1, 2026, the average yearly pay for fresh graduate chemical engineer in the United States is $87,487.00, according to ZipRecruiter salary data. Most workers in this role earn between $67,500.00 and $106,500.00 per year, depending on experience, location, and employer.

What is a Fresh Graduate Chemical Engineer job?

A Fresh Graduate Chemical Engineer job is an entry-level position designed for recent graduates with a degree in chemical engineering. These roles typically involve assisting in research, process design, quality control, or production in industries like oil and gas, pharmaceuticals, or manufacturing. Fresh graduates may work under the supervision of experienced engineers, gaining hands-on experience in chemical processes, safety regulations, and engineering principles. The job aims to develop technical skills, problem-solving abilities, and industry-specific knowledge. It serves as a foundation for career growth in various chemical engineering fields.

What are the key skills and qualifications needed to thrive in the Fresh Graduate Chemical Engineer position, and why are they important?

To thrive as a Fresh Graduate Chemical Engineer, you need a solid background in chemical engineering principles, process design, and safety protocols, typically obtained through an accredited engineering degree. Familiarity with simulation software like Aspen HYSYS, AutoCAD, and adherence to safety standards such as OSHA are highly beneficial. Strong analytical thinking, effective teamwork, and clear communication skills will help you stand out in entry-level positions. These qualities are crucial for ensuring safe, efficient operations and smooth collaboration in multidisciplinary engineering environments.

What kinds of projects or responsibilities can a fresh graduate chemical engineer expect in their first year on the job?

As a fresh graduate chemical engineer, you can expect to work on tasks such as assisting with process optimization, supporting troubleshooting efforts in production, collecting and analyzing data, and preparing technical documentation under the supervision of experienced engineers. Often, you'll be part of a collaborative team where you'll learn from mentors while gradually taking on more responsibility. You might also participate in safety audits, pilot plant trials, and cross-departmental meetings to gain broader exposure. These experiences are designed to build your technical competencies and help integrate you smoothly into professional engineering settings.

Additional qualification information for Industrial Hygienist can be found from the following Office of Personnel Management website: https://www.opm.gov/policy-data-oversight/classification-qualifications/general-schedule-qualification-standards/0600/industrial-hygiene-series-0690/ For GS-0893-05 : A.

Degree: Engineering. To be acceptable, the program must: (1) lead to a bachelor's degree in a school of engineering with at least one program accredited by ABET; or (2) include differential and integral calculus and courses (more advanced than first-year physics and chemistry) in five of the following seven areas of engineering science or physics: (a) statics, dynamics; (b) strength of materials (stress-strain relationships); (c) fluid mechanics, hydraulics; (d) thermodynamics; (e) electrical fields and circuits; (f) nature and properties of materials (relating particle and aggregate structure to properties); and (g) any other comparable area of fundamental engineering science or physics, such as optics, heat transfer, soil mechanics, or electronics. OR B.

Combination of education and experience -- college-level education, training, and/or technical experience that furnished (1) a thorough knowledge of the physical and mathematical sciences underlying engineering, and (2) a good understanding, both theoretical and practical, of the engineering sciences and techniques and their applications to one of the branches of engineering. The adequacy of such background must be demonstrated by one of the following: * Professional registration or licensure -- Current registration as an Engineer Intern (EI), Engineer in Training (EIT)1 , or licensure as a Professional Engineer (PE) by any State, the District of Columbia, Guam, or Puerto Rico. Absent other means of qualifying under this standard, those applicants who achieved such registration by means other than written test (e.g., State grandfather or eminence provisions) are eligible only for positions that are within or closely related to the specialty field of their registration.

For example, an applicant who attains registration through a State Board's eminence provision as a manufacturing engineer typically would be rated eligible only for manufacturing engineering positions. * Written Test -- Evidence of having successfully passed the Fundamentals of Engineering (FE)2 examination or any other written test required for professional registration by an engineering licensure board in the various States, the District of Columbia, Guam, and Puerto Rico. * Specified academic courses -- Successful completion of at least 60 semester hours of courses in the physical, mathematical, and engineering sciences and that included the courses specified in the basic requirements under paragraph A.

The courses must be fully acceptable toward meeting the requirements of an engineering program as described in paragraph A. * Related curriculum -- Successful completion of a curriculum leading to a bachelor's degree in an appropriate scientific field, e.g., engineering technology, physics, chemistry, architecture, computer science, mathematics, hydrology, or geology, may be accepted in lieu of a bachelor's degree in engineering, provided the applicant has had at least 1 year of professional engineering experience acquired under professional engineering supervision and guidance. Ordinarily there should be either an established plan of intensive training to develop professional engineering competence, or several years of prior professional engineering-type experience, e.g., in interdisciplinary positions.

(The above examples of related curricula are not all-inclusive.)
